What are cookies?

Cookies are small text files that our web server sends to your computer, smartphone or tablet when you visit this website. They are stored in the internet browser you are using.

The cookies we use are in no way associated with and do not disclose any personal data of users of the site. They help us to provide a better website by helping us to improve users’ experience of the site.

Cookies in no way give us access to your computer or information about you.

What types of cookies does the site use?

Analytical cookies – these cookies allow us to track website traffic and analyse user experience on the website. According to the analysis made, they enable us to assess whether changes are necessary in order to facilitate the use of the site. 

Our website uses Google Analytics, a service provided by Google Inc. that helps us analyse traffic and user behaviour. The information collected (e.g. IP address, device type, behaviour) is transmitted to Google servers and may be stored outside the European Union. We only use Google Analytics after consent has been obtained via the cookie banner.

These cookies do not give us information about the personal data of users. They tell us which pages of the website you have viewed, whether you visited the website via a mobile device, tablet or computer. This helps us to improve the website to tailor it to your needs. This information is only used for statistical analysis purposes, after which the data is removed from the system.

Functional cookies – these allow you to use the full functionality of the website. These cookies save visitors’ settings and preferences for future visits. They may store information about language, region selection and other personalised settings that do not affect personal identification but make interacting with the site more convenient.

For how long is the data collected by cookies stored?

If the user consents to the use of cookies, the data is stored for a period of one year. If the user refuses consent, the refusal information is stored for a period of three months to ensure that cookies will not be installed on their device. Users can change their consent or preferences at any time through their browser settings.

Change cookie settings

If you want to restrict or block cookies on this website, you can do so by changing the settings on your internet browser. This may prevent you from making the most of the website and remove some functionality.

You can block all cookies, accept only some cookies or delete all cookies when you exit your browser. More information is available from your browser’s help menu.
